Frequently Asked Questions

What is Cousin (2025) about?

*Cousin* follows Antón as he travels to his grandparents' village for his first communion, a journey that becomes far more than a religious milestone. Through the warmth of family bonds and the rhythms of rural life, the film captures his awakening to new perspectives and the quiet moments that define his identity. It's a story about faith, belonging, and the invisible threads that connect us to our roots.

Who directed Cousin?

Alejandro Jato brings *Cousin* to life, crafting a delicate portrait of family and self-discovery with his nuanced direction.

Who stars in Cousin?

The film features Xurxo Cuquejo as Antón, with Brais Sixto, Melania Cruz, Denís Gómez, Susana Sampedro, and Alba Blanco rounding out the ensemble cast.

How long is Cousin?

Cousin runs for 24 minutes, delivering a concise yet impactful cinematic experience.
